Quarterly Planning Note — Warranty-Cost Overrun. For the board of Thornquist Appliances. Warranty claims on the Evenlode range exceeded provision by roughly a third this quarter, traced chiefly to a compressor seal sourced from Marlow Fabrication. Corrective actions: supplier audit, revised inbound testing, and an uplifted provision for two quarters. The confidential note on associated business plans follows immediately below.

board note of yahaf-kahog: The pricing group signed off on a budget of $340.6 million for Project Zoreth.

Subject: Inkwell markdown pipeline 5.1 deployed

On-call: the Inkwell rendering pipeline is now on 5.1 in production. Changes: sanitizer runs before the table parser, footnote rendering is cached per document, and the fallback plain-text path no longer strips headings. If render latency alarms fire, roll back via the standard script — it handles cache invalidation. Known issue: nested blockquotes over six levels render flat. The deployment trace token follows.

build token for hawep-kageg: htk14_558814e2114cc7

// Extraction notes: the user module is being carved out of the Brindlewood
// monolith into the Ostrel service. These constants gate the dual-write
// window. Do not touch retry caps until the shadow reads in Ostrel match
// Brindlewood for a full week. Delete this block once cutover completes
// and the legacy tables are dropped. Values below were chosen during the
// Q3 migration drills and are documented in the runbook. The current tuning constants are as follows.

tuning constants:
RATE_LIMITS = {
    "ralwyn": 2,
    "druath": 10,
    "ralix": 1,
    "quenath": 10,
}